Braille 'signed' on sleeved bottles

Italy’s Brescia Milk Depot debuts Braille via hot-melt adhesive dots applied to shrink-sleeved milk bottles.

Pw 7199 Latte Inset

The Brescia Milk Depot, an Italian milk producer based in Brescia, is using an innovative packaging solution to help it serve the needs of a narrow, yet important, customer segment—the visually impaired.

Responding to a request in the fall of 2005 from the Italian Association for the Blind and Visually Handicapped, the Milk Depot embarked on a plan to add expiration dates in Braille to its milk products.

According to Milk Depot CEO Andrea Bartolozzi, the challenge fit well with the Milk Depot’s overall approach to business because the new initiative was consistent with the company’s goal to be socially responsible as well as profitable.
